A major storm pounded California’s central coast on Monday, bringing flooding and high surf that was blamed for fatally trapping a man beneath debris on a beach and later partially collapsing a pier, tossing three people into the Pacific Ocean.

The storm was expected to bring hurricane-force winds and waves up to 60 feet (18 metres) as it gained strength from California to the Pacific Northwest.
